The 3rd and 5th terms of an arithmetic sequence are 197 and 173. What is the 4th term?
180
161
221
185

the difference between the 5th and the 3rd term is 24, so what you can do is subtract 12 from 197 and add 12 from 173 and the answer comes out to be 185.
